Kansas City Royals utility player Ryan O'Hearn is not in the starting lineup for Tuesday's interleague road game against left-hander Brett Anderson and the Milwaukee Brewers.
The Royals are playing without their designated hitter in a National League park as they open up a two-game set. Jorge Soler is starting in right field over O'Hearn and hitting sixth.
numberFire’s models project Soler for 9.4 FanDuel points on Tuesday and he has a $6,000 salary on the one-game slate. Anderson's xwOBA (.379), xERA (6.44), and strikeout rate (14.1 percent) all rank in the bottom two percent among qualified starters this season.
